Você está na página 1de 16

Peer to Peer

Redes de Computadores
Ariel, Felipe e Gabriel
O que é?
Requisitos:
➔ Escalabilidade global
➔ Otimização de interações
➔ Disponibilidade
➔ Segurança dos dados
➔ Anonimidade, negabilidade e
resistência à censura
Direitos autorais
P2P e o temido copyright
Arquiteturas
Centralizada Descentralizada Híbrida
Utiliza um servidor central Todos os peers possuem Alguns peers especiais,
para controle de acesso à funcionalidade equivalente, chamados supernós,
rede e para publicação e o que gera um alto tráfego possuem um papel
pesquisa de conteúdo, na rede. Além disso, o diferenciado na rede.
enquanto o acesso aos desempenho das pesquisas
recursos é feito é ruim.
diretamente entre peers.
Pontos fortes
Autoescabilidade Relação custo-benefício
Mesmo que cada par gere uma carga de Redes peer-to-peer, em geral, não
trabalho solicitando arquivos, também requerem infraestrutura e largura de
acrescenta capacidade de serviço ao banda de servidores de maneira
sistema distribuindo arquivos a outros significativa.
pares.
Pontos fracos
Complexidade de Segurança
implementação Em razão de sua natureza altamente
Sistemas descentralizados e tão distribuída e exposta, as aplicações
escalonáveis são bastantes complexos de P2P podem representar um desafio
se desenvolver, principalmente quanto à no que se trata de proteção.
tolerância de falhas e à busca de recursos.
Grande Shawn
Fanning e o Napster
Quem conhece esse
logo?
Torrent! O seu amigo pirata.
Aplicações
Gnutella DNS Infinit
Rede de compartilhamento, Sistema que mistura Sistema de
altamente descentralizada. conceitos de p2p com um compartilhamento de
modelo hierárquico de arquivos com alta taxas de
posse de informações transmissão.
BitTorrent
Atores
➔ Seed
➔ Publisher
➔ Leecher
➔ Tracker
Referências
1. http://www.inf.ufsc.br/~frank.siq
ueira/INE5418/2.3.P2P-Slides.pdf
2. http://monografias.poli.ufrj.br/mo
nografias/monopoli10014186.pdf
3. https://www.youtube.com/watch?
v=OFswNCU5CKA
4. KUROSE, J; ROSS, K; Redes de
Computadores e A Internet - Uma
Abordagem Top-Down, 5ª ed,
Pearson, 2013.